Mezzi Paccheri is a shorter and refined variant of the famous, large Paccheri from the Campania region. This 'half' tube pasta combines a generous diameter with a shorter length, making it slightly lighter to eat and beautifully elegant when standing upright on the plate. It is an extremely versatile type of pasta in Italian cuisine: due to its large, open structure, the sauce flows effortlessly inside. This makes the pasta particularly suitable for rich sauces with tender pieces of meat (ragù), coarse vegetables or refined seafood. Additionally, this shape is very popular for briefly gratinée in the oven for a deliciously crispy crust.
